Record the scene of the accident
Photographing the scene of the accident could be a crucial part of your claim for compensation. Photographs can assist you in proving liability, show the accident and document the damage. The pictures you take can be used as evidence in civil court cases.
It is essential to record the scene of the accident as soon and as accurately as possible. Photographs can assist in getting a feel of the scene before and after the incident. They can also give you crucial details about the injuries you sustained or the damage to your property. To capture the most important aspects of the incident, you should capture photos from multiple angles.
After taking photos, you can measure the cars and the area around them. Skid marks or other road marks can give valuable information about the speed of the vehicle at the time of the collision.
It is also crucial to gather the contact information of any witnesses. By gathering their contact information, you can have an increased chance of getting the necessary information for your claim.
Also, take photographs of the license plate. This will help prove that the driver was the one to blame. If you find that the other driver isn't willing to cooperate, you could ask the police for assistance to you obtain their information.
Photographing the scene of a truck crash is among the most effective ways to collect evidence prior to the vehicles are moved. These photos can prove helpful in a jury trial. They can also be used to back your medical or insurance claims.

Subpoenas are an effective method to collect evidence in an accident involving a truck. Subpoenas can be issued by an attorney after court approval. This will permit the attorney to dictate the production time and enforce it by imposing monetary fines.
Another instance is a blackbox. Black boxes are tiny electronic devices that are placed in large trucks. They collect data about truck operation. The data they collect is useful for a variety of reasons. For instance the black box could be used to reconstruct the scene.
One of the most intriguing aspects of the black box, is that it has information on the way the truck was operating at the time of the crash. It is important to remember that the equipment in a commercial vehicle can be as vital as its driver.
Another evidence to collect is an accident report. The majority of these reports are accessible for several days following an accident.
